First Friday Means Business
First Friday Means Business held monthly, averages between 75 and 90 attendees. This informational meeting includes the City Talk, County Talk, Chamber Talk and Sponsor Talk, along with a guest speaker. This event is great for those who can’t attend events after regular business hours.
Membership Appreciation Day and Trade Show
The Chamber, with the help from its Members, hosts the Annual Membership Appreciation Day to say "Thank You" to the membership. This event also provides the opportunity for Chamber members to promote their business and services at a Trade Show.
Business After Hours
Business After Hours held monthly, averages between 150 and 300 attendees. The event provides excellent networking opportunities allowing attendees to meet new clients and customers.
Ribbon Cuttings/Ground Breakings
The Chamber of Commerce will assist with ribbon cutting/groundbreaking ceremonies for new businesses, new locations, or new ownership for any Chamber member.  The Chamber sends invitations to the media, local dignitaries, Chamber ambassadors and Board of Directors, and follows up by sending press releases to the Courier Herald to be published.
